Or have you tried the US? Learning their weird transfer system is challenging enough (drafts etc..) but they also have the MLS split vertically (east and west) into two tiny leagues (almost like season-long group stages) until the playoffs at the end.

Also the biggest challenges are the ones that don't allow for foreign players or at least place severe restrictions on them.
Or you could take charge of Athletic in Spain who can only sign players with Basque nationality - never tried that one myself but its on my list lol.
Another idea is to take over a doomed club at a different point in the season by selecting view-only leagues which start at differerent times - some start as early as 2008 and some as late as 2010 - check it out on the new game screen - you don't actually have to manage in those countries to be able to use their season-start date for your game as long as they are selected.
